    Thank you for contacting us regarding our internet coupon policy. We appreciate the opportunity to assist you.
    Internet coupons printed from a website are redeemable with a qualifying purchase. Supervalu DOES NOT accept internet coupons containing the following conditions:
    Free product offers that do not require a purchase
    Redemption value exceeds $5.00
    Absence of UPC bar code are other retailer company discount offers. Competitor coupons maybe honored on merchandise purchased at your store at the face value of the coupon within the valid dates of the coupon.

    I spoke to CS today at my store. She said that what is meant by no 'free' means if the IP is for free product - meaning, just go get it and its free. She said that we can still get stuff free if the IP is the same dollar amount as the cost of the item. For instance, the $1 progresso soup sale...the $1.10 q's were OK, however they had to adjust them down to $1 so no overage - but free product. B1G1 IPs are ok too.
